Key Supplements for Men’s Sexual Health
L-arginine, an amino acid that helps produce nitric oxide, may improve blood flow to erectile tissue. Ginseng has demonstrated potential benefits for ED in clinical studies. Another popular supplement, DHEA, naturally decreases with age and may help improve erectile function when levels are restored through supplementation. However, it’s important to note that supplement effectiveness can vary among individuals.
Natural Approaches for Elderly Men
Senior men can benefit from a holistic approach to treating ED. Regular exercise, particularly aerobic activities and pelvic floor exercises, can improve blood circulation and strengthen relevant muscles. Stress reduction techniques, such as meditation and yoga, may also help address psychological factors contributing to ED.
Diet and Lifestyle Modifications
A heart-healthy Mediterranean-style di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ins can support erectile function. Reducing alcohol consumption, quitting smoking, and maintaining a healthy weight are equally important lifestyle modifications that can improve ED symptoms in elderly men.
Integrating Supplements with Traditional Medicine
While natural treatments can be effective, they should be integrated thoughtfully with any existing medical treatments. Some supplements may interact with prescription medications, particularly those commonly taken by seniors for heart conditions or blood pressure.
